Scottish Folds, no matter whether with folded ears or with normal ears, are usually good-natured and placid and change to other animals within a house extremely properly. They tend to become pretty attached for their human caregivers and they are by nature rather affectionate. They adore human companionship and display this in their unique quiet way. Folds obtain significant marks for playfulness, affection, and grooming, and are sometimes clever, loyal, smooth spoken, and adaptable to home scenarios and other people. Scottish Folds adapt to almost any household situation and therefore are as at ease in a space brimming with noisy small children and canines as They may be in one human being’s dwelling.

Scottish Fold cats might have either solitary, double, or triple folded ears. Only one fold indicates just the highest of your ear is bent. Double folds generally have about 50 percent of your ear folded down. A full triple fold is once the ears are flat to The pinnacle.

Osteochondrodysplasia is a disease that is unique to Scottish Folds. It was discovered that if a folded ear Scottish fold was bred to another folded ear, many of the offspring developed a severe crippling lameness early in life. Cats affected had shortened, malformed legs and tail as well as abnormalities affecting the growth plates and spine. Scottish folds should be bred ONLY folded ear to straight ear and are not to be bred by people who are not dedicated to the health and well-being of these animals. We genetically test all our breeding cats for the fold gene and never, ever breed fold to fold.
